<span id="sphx-glr-tutorials-training-agents-blackjack-tutorial-py"></span><h1>Solving Blackjack with Q-Learning<a class="headerlink" href="#solving-blackjack-with-q-learning" title="Permalink to this heading">#</a></h1>
|
||
<a class="only-light reference internal image-reference" href="../../../_images/blackjack_AE_loop.jpg"><img alt="agent-environment-diagram" class="only-light" src="../../../_images/blackjack_AE_loop.jpg" style="width: 650px;" /></a>
|
||
<a class="only-dark reference internal image-reference" href="../../../_images/blackjack_AE_loop_dark.png"><img alt="agent-environment-diagram" class="only-dark" src="../../../_images/blackjack_AE_loop_dark.png" style="width: 650px;" /></a>
|
||
<p>In this tutorial, we’ll explore and solve the <em>Blackjack-v1</em>
|
||
environment.</p>
|
||
<p><strong>Blackjack</strong> is one of the most popular casino card games that is also
|
||
infamous for being beatable under certain conditions. This version of
|
||
the game uses an infinite deck (we draw the cards with replacement), so
|
||
counting cards won’t be a viable strategy in our simulated game.
|
||
Full documentation can be found at <a class="reference external" href="https://gymnasium.farama.org/environments/toy_text/blackjack">https://gymnasium.farama.org/environments/toy_text/blackjack</a></p>
|
||
<p><strong>Objective</strong>: To win, your card sum should be greater than the
|
||
dealers without exceeding 21.</p>
|
||
<dl class="simple">
|
||
<dt><strong>Actions</strong>: Agents can pick between two actions:</dt><dd><ul class="simple">
|
||
<li><p>stand (0): the player takes no more cards</p></li>
|
||
<li><p>hit (1): the player will be given another card, however the player could get over 21 and bust</p></li>
|
||
</ul>
|
||
</dd>
|
||
</dl>
|
||
<p><strong>Approach</strong>: To solve this environment by yourself, you can pick your
|
||
favorite discrete RL algorithm. The presented solution uses <em>Q-learning</em>
|
||
(a model-free RL algorithm).</p>

<h2>Observing the environment<a class="headerlink" href="#observing-the-environment" title="Permalink to this heading">#</a></h2>
|
||
<p>First of all, we call <code class="docutils literal notranslate"><span class="pre">env.reset()</span></code> to start an episode. This function
|
||
resets the environment to a starting position and returns an initial
|
||
<code class="docutils literal notranslate"><span class="pre">observation</span></code>. We usually also set <code class="docutils literal notranslate"><span class="pre">done</span> <span class="pre">=</span> <span class="pre">False</span></code>. This variable
|
||
will be useful later to check if a game is terminated (i.e., the player wins or loses).</p>
|
||
<div class="highlight-default notranslate"><div class="highlight"><pre><span></span><span class="c1"># reset the environment to get the first observation</span>
|
||
<span class="n">done</span> <span class="o">=</span> <span class="kc">False</span>
|
||
<span class="n">observation</span><span class="p">,</span> <span class="n">info</span> <span class="o">=</span> <span class="n">env</span><span class="o">.</span><span class="n">reset</span><span class="p">()</span>
|
||
|
||
<span class="c1"># observation = (16, 9, False)</span>
|
||
</pre></div>
|
||
</div>
|
||
<p>Note that our observation is a 3-tuple consisting of 3 values:</p>
|
||
<ul class="simple">
|
||
<li><p>The players current sum</p></li>
|
||
<li><p>Value of the dealers face-up card</p></li>
|
||
<li><p>Boolean whether the player holds a usable ace (An ace is usable if it
|
||
counts as 11 without busting)</p></li>
|
||
</ul>
|
||
</section>
|
||
<section id="executing-an-action">
|
||
<h2>Executing an action<a class="headerlink" href="#executing-an-action" title="Permalink to this heading">#</a></h2>
|
||
<p>After receiving our first observation, we are only going to use the
|
||
<code class="docutils literal notranslate"><span class="pre">env.step(action)</span></code> function to interact with the environment. This
|
||
function takes an action as input and executes it in the environment.
|
||
Because that action changes the state of the environment, it returns
|
||
four useful variables to us. These are:</p>
|
||
<ul class="simple">
|
||
<li><p><code class="docutils literal notranslate"><span class="pre">next_state</span></code>: This is the observation that the agent will receive
|
||
after taking the action.</p></li>
|
||
<li><p><code class="docutils literal notranslate"><span class="pre">reward</span></code>: This is the reward that the agent will receive after
|
||
taking the action.</p></li>
|
||
<li><p><code class="docutils literal notranslate"><span class="pre">terminated</span></code>: This is a boolean variable that indicates whether or
|
||
not the environment has terminated.</p></li>
|
||
<li><p><code class="docutils literal notranslate"><span class="pre">truncated</span></code>: This is a boolean variable that also indicates whether
|
||
the episode ended by early truncation, i.e., a time limit is reached.</p></li>
|
||
<li><p><code class="docutils literal notranslate"><span class="pre">info</span></code>: This is a dictionary that might contain additional
|
||
information about the environment.</p></li>
|
||
</ul>
|
||
<p>The <code class="docutils literal notranslate"><span class="pre">next_state</span></code>, <code class="docutils literal notranslate"><span class="pre">reward</span></code>, <code class="docutils literal notranslate"><span class="pre">terminated</span></code> and <code class="docutils literal notranslate"><span class="pre">truncated</span></code> variables are
|
||
self-explanatory, but the <code class="docutils literal notranslate"><span class="pre">info</span></code> variable requires some additional
|
||
explanation. This variable contains a dictionary that might have some
|
||
extra information about the environment, but in the Blackjack-v1
|
||
environment you can ignore it. For example in Atari environments the
|
||
info dictionary has a <code class="docutils literal notranslate"><span class="pre">ale.lives</span></code> key that tells us how many lives the
|
||
agent has left. If the agent has 0 lives, then the episode is over.</p>
|
||
<p>Note that it is not a good idea to call <code class="docutils literal notranslate"><span class="pre">env.render()</span></code> in your training
|
||
loop because rendering slows down training by a lot. Rather try to build
|
||
an extra loop to evaluate and showcase the agent after training.</p>
|
||
<div class="highlight-default notranslate"><div class="highlight"><pre><span></span><span class="c1"># sample a random action from all valid actions</span>
|
||
<span class="n">action</span> <span class="o">=</span> <span class="n">env</span><span class="o">.</span><span class="n">action_space</span><span class="o">.</span><span class="n">sample</span><span class="p">()</span>
|
||
<span class="c1"># action=1</span>
|
||
|
||
<span class="c1"># execute the action in our environment and receive infos from the environment</span>
|
||
<span class="n">observation</span><span class="p">,</span> <span class="n">reward</span><span class="p">,</span> <span class="n">terminated</span><span class="p">,</span> <span class="n">truncated</span><span class="p">,</span> <span class="n">info</span> <span class="o">=</span> <span class="n">env</span><span class="o">.</span><span class="n">step</span><span class="p">(</span><span class="n">action</span><span class="p">)</span>
|
||
|
||
<span class="c1"># observation=(24, 10, False)</span>
|
||
<span class="c1"># reward=-1.0</span>
|
||
<span class="c1"># terminated=True</span>
|
||
<span class="c1"># truncated=False</span>
|
||
<span class="c1"># info={}</span>
|
||
</pre></div>
|
||
</div>
|
||
<p>Once <code class="docutils literal notranslate"><span class="pre">terminated</span> <span class="pre">=</span> <span class="pre">True</span></code> or <code class="docutils literal notranslate"><span class="pre">truncated=True</span></code>, we should stop the
|
||
current episode and begin a new one with <code class="docutils literal notranslate"><span class="pre">env.reset()</span></code>. If you
|
||
continue executing actions without resetting the environment, it still
|
||
responds but the output won’t be useful for training (it might even be
|
||
harmful if the agent learns on invalid data).</p>

<h2>Building an agent<a class="headerlink" href="#building-an-agent" title="Permalink to this heading">#</a></h2>
|
||
<p>Let’s build a <code class="docutils literal notranslate"><span class="pre">Q-learning</span> <span class="pre">agent</span></code> to solve <em>Blackjack-v1</em>! We’ll need
|
||
some functions for picking an action and updating the agents action
|
||
values. To ensure that the agents explores the environment, one possible
|
||
solution is the <code class="docutils literal notranslate"><span class="pre">epsilon-greedy</span></code> strategy, where we pick a random
|
||
action with the percentage <code class="docutils literal notranslate"><span class="pre">epsilon</span></code> and the greedy action (currently
|
||
valued as the best) <code class="docutils literal notranslate"><span class="pre">1</span> <span class="pre">-</span> <span class="pre">epsilon</span></code>.</p>
|
||
<div class="highlight-default notranslate"><div class="highlight"><pre><span></span><span class="k">class</span> <span class="nc">BlackjackAgent</span><span class="p">:</span>
|
||
<span class="k">def</span> <span class="fm">__init__</span><span class="p">(</span>
|
||
<span class="bp">self</span><span class="p">,</span>
|
||
<span class="n">learning_rate</span><span class="p">:</span> <span class="nb">float</span><span class="p">,</span>
|
||
<span class="n">initial_epsilon</span><span class="p">:</span> <span class="nb">float</span><span class="p">,</span>
|
||
<span class="n">epsilon_decay</span><span class="p">:</span> <span class="nb">float</span><span class="p">,</span>
|
||
<span class="n">final_epsilon</span><span class="p">:</span> <span class="nb">float</span><span class="p">,</span>
|
||
<span class="n">discount_factor</span><span class="p">:</span> <span class="nb">float</span> <span class="o">=</span> <span class="mf">0.95</span><span class="p">,</span>
|
||
<span class="p">):</span>
|
||
<span class="w"> </span><span class="sd">"""Initialize a Reinforcement Learning agent with an empty dictionary</span>
|
||
<span class="sd"> of state-action values (q_values), a learning rate and an epsilon.</span>
|
||
|
||
<span class="sd"> Args:</span>
|
||
<span class="sd"> learning_rate: The learning rate</span>
|
||
<span class="sd"> initial_epsilon: The initial epsilon value</span>
|
||
<span class="sd"> epsilon_decay: The decay for epsilon</span>
|
||
<span class="sd"> final_epsilon: The final epsilon value</span>
|
||
<span class="sd"> discount_factor: The discount factor for computing the Q-value</span>
|
||
<span class="sd"> """</span>
|
||
<span class="bp">self</span><span class="o">.</span><span class="n">q_values</span> <span class="o">=</span> <span class="n">defaultdict</span><span class="p">(</span><span class="k">lambda</span><span class="p">:</span> <span class="n">np</span><span class="o">.</span><span class="n">zeros</span><span class="p">(</span><span class="n">env</span><span class="o">.</span><span class="n">action_space</span><span class="o">.</span><span class="n">n</span><span class="p">))</span>
|
||
|
||
<span class="bp">self</span><span class="o">.</span><span class="n">lr</span> <span class="o">=</span> <span class="n">learning_rate</span>
|
||
<span class="bp">self</span><span class="o">.</span><span class="n">discount_factor</span> <span class="o">=</span> <span class="n">discount_factor</span>
|
||
|
||
<span class="bp">self</span><span class="o">.</span><span class="n">epsilon</span> <span class="o">=</span> <span class="n">initial_epsilon</span>
|
||
<span class="bp">self</span><span class="o">.</span><span class="n">epsilon_decay</span> <span class="o">=</span> <span class="n">epsilon_decay</span>
|
||
<span class="bp">self</span><span class="o">.</span><span class="n">final_epsilon</span> <span class="o">=</span> <span class="n">final_epsilon</span>
|
||
|
||
<span class="bp">self</span><span class="o">.</span><span class="n">training_error</span> <span class="o">=</span> <span class="p">[]</span>
|
||
|
||
<span class="k">def</span> <span class="nf">get_action</span><span class="p">(</span><span class="bp">self</span><span class="p">,</span> <span class="n">obs</span><span class="p">:</span> <span class="nb">tuple</span><span class="p">[</span><span class="nb">int</span><span class="p">,</span> <span class="nb">int</span><span class="p">,</span> <span class="nb">bool</span><span class="p">])</span> <span class="o">-></span> <span class="nb">int</span><span class="p">:</span>
|
||
<span class="w"> </span><span class="sd">"""</span>
|
||
<span class="sd"> Returns the best action with probability (1 - epsilon)</span>
|
||
<span class="sd"> otherwise a random action with probability epsilon to ensure exploration.</span>
|
||
<span class="sd"> """</span>
|
||
<span class="c1"># with probability epsilon return a random action to explore the environment</span>
|
||
<span class="k">if</span> <span class="n">np</span><span class="o">.</span><span class="n">random</span><span class="o">.</span><span class="n">random</span><span class="p">()</span> <span class="o"><</span> <span class="bp">self</span><span class="o">.</span><span class="n">epsilon</span><span class="p">:</span>
|
||
<span class="k">return</span> <span class="n">env</span><span class="o">.</span><span class="n">action_space</span><span class="o">.</span><span class="n">sample</span><span class="p">()</span>
|
||
|
||
<span class="c1"># with probability (1 - epsilon) act greedily (exploit)</span>
|
||
<span class="k">else</span><span class="p">:</span>
|
||
<span class="k">return</span> <span class="nb">int</span><span class="p">(</span><span class="n">np</span><span class="o">.</span><span class="n">argmax</span><span class="p">(</span><span class="bp">self</span><span class="o">.</span><span class="n">q_values</span><span class="p">[</span><span class="n">obs</span><span class="p">]))</span>
|
||
|
||
<span class="k">def</span> <span class="nf">update</span><span class="p">(</span>
|
||
<span class="bp">self</span><span class="p">,</span>
|
||
<span class="n">obs</span><span class="p">:</span> <span class="nb">tuple</span><span class="p">[</span><span class="nb">int</span><span class="p">,</span> <span class="nb">int</span><span class="p">,</span> <span class="nb">bool</span><span class="p">],</span>
|
||
<span class="n">action</span><span class="p">:</span> <span class="nb">int</span><span class="p">,</span>
|
||
<span class="n">reward</span><span class="p">:</span> <span class="nb">float</span><span class="p">,</span>
|
||
<span class="n">terminated</span><span class="p">:</span> <span class="nb">bool</span><span class="p">,</span>
|
||
<span class="n">next_obs</span><span class="p">:</span> <span class="nb">tuple</span><span class="p">[</span><span class="nb">int</span><span class="p">,</span> <span class="nb">int</span><span class="p">,</span> <span class="nb">bool</span><span class="p">],</span>
|
||
<span class="p">):</span>
|
||
<span class="w"> </span><span class="sd">"""Updates the Q-value of an action."""</span>
|
||
<span class="n">future_q_value</span> <span class="o">=</span> <span class="p">(</span><span class="ow">not</span> <span class="n">terminated</span><span class="p">)</span> <span class="o">*</span> <span class="n">np</span><span class="o">.</span><span class="n">max</span><span class="p">(</span><span class="bp">self</span><span class="o">.</span><span class="n">q_values</span><span class="p">[</span><span class="n">next_obs</span><span class="p">])</span>
|
||
<span class="n">temporal_difference</span> <span class="o">=</span> <span class="p">(</span>
|
||
<span class="n">reward</span> <span class="o">+</span> <span class="bp">self</span><span class="o">.</span><span class="n">discount_factor</span> <span class="o">*</span> <span class="n">future_q_value</span> <span class="o">-</span> <span class="bp">self</span><span class="o">.</span><span class="n">q_values</span><span class="p">[</span><span class="n">obs</span><span class="p">][</span><span class="n">action</span><span class="p">]</span>
|
||
<span class="p">)</span>
|
||
|
||
<span class="bp">self</span><span class="o">.</span><span class="n">q_values</span><span class="p">[</span><span class="n">obs</span><span class="p">][</span><span class="n">action</span><span class="p">]</span> <span class="o">=</span> <span class="p">(</span>
|
||
<span class="bp">self</span><span class="o">.</span><span class="n">q_values</span><span class="p">[</span><span class="n">obs</span><span class="p">][</span><span class="n">action</span><span class="p">]</span> <span class="o">+</span> <span class="bp">self</span><span class="o">.</span><span class="n">lr</span> <span class="o">*</span> <span class="n">temporal_difference</span>
|
||
<span class="p">)</span>
|
||
<span class="bp">self</span><span class="o">.</span><span class="n">training_error</span><span class="o">.</span><span class="n">append</span><span class="p">(</span><span class="n">temporal_difference</span><span class="p">)</span>
|
||
|
||
<span class="k">def</span> <span class="nf">decay_epsilon</span><span class="p">(</span><span class="bp">self</span><span class="p">):</span>
|
||
<span class="bp">self</span><span class="o">.</span><span class="n">epsilon</span> <span class="o">=</span> <span class="nb">max</span><span class="p">(</span><span class="bp">self</span><span class="o">.</span><span class="n">final_epsilon</span><span class="p">,</span> <span class="bp">self</span><span class="o">.</span><span class="n">epsilon</span> <span class="o">-</span> <span class="n">epsilon_decay</span><span class="p">)</span>
|
||
</pre></div>
|
||
</div>
|
||
<p>To train the agent, we will let the agent play one episode (one complete
|
||
game is called an episode) at a time and then update it’s Q-values after
|
||
each episode. The agent will have to experience a lot of episodes to
|
||
explore the environment sufficiently.</p>
|
||
<p>Now we should be ready to build the training loop.</p>
|
||
<div class="highlight-default notranslate"><div class="highlight"><pre><span></span><span class="c1"># hyperparameters</span>
|
||
<span class="n">learning_rate</span> <span class="o">=</span> <span class="mf">0.01</span>
|
||
<span class="n">n_episodes</span> <span class="o">=</span> <span class="mi">100_000</span>
|
||
<span class="n">start_epsilon</span> <span class="o">=</span> <span class="mf">1.0</span>
|
||
<span class="n">epsilon_decay</span> <span class="o">=</span> <span class="n">start_epsilon</span> <span class="o">/</span> <span class="p">(</span><span class="n">n_episodes</span> <span class="o">/</span> <span class="mi">2</span><span class="p">)</span> <span class="c1"># reduce the exploration over time</span>
|
||
<span class="n">final_epsilon</span> <span class="o">=</span> <span class="mf">0.1</span>
|
||
|
||
<span class="n">agent</span> <span class="o">=</span> <span class="n">BlackjackAgent</span><span class="p">(</span>
|
||
<span class="n">learning_rate</span><span class="o">=</span><span class="n">learning_rate</span><span class="p">,</span>
|
||
<span class="n">initial_epsilon</span><span class="o">=</span><span class="n">start_epsilon</span><span class="p">,</span>
|
||
<span class="n">epsilon_decay</span><span class="o">=</span><span class="n">epsilon_decay</span><span class="p">,</span>
|
||
<span class="n">final_epsilon</span><span class="o">=</span><span class="n">final_epsilon</span><span class="p">,</span>
|
||
<span class="p">)</span>
|
||
</pre></div>
|
||
</div>
|
||
<p>Great, let’s train!</p>
|
||
<p>Info: The current hyperparameters are set to quickly train a decent agent.
|
||
If you want to converge to the optimal policy, try increasing
|
||
the n_episodes by 10x and lower the learning_rate (e.g. to 0.001).</p>
|
||
<div class="highlight-default notranslate"><div class="highlight"><pre><span></span><span class="n">env</span> <span class="o">=</span> <span class="n">gym</span><span class="o">.</span><span class="n">wrappers</span><span class="o">.</span><span class="n">RecordEpisodeStatistics</span><span class="p">(</span><span class="n">env</span><span class="p">,</span> <span class="n">deque_size</span><span class="o">=</span><span class="n">n_episodes</span><span class="p">)</span>
|
||
<span class="k">for</span> <span class="n">episode</span> <span class="ow">in</span> <span class="n">tqdm</span><span class="p">(</span><span class="nb">range</span><span class="p">(</span><span class="n">n_episodes</span><span class="p">)):</span>
|
||
<span class="n">obs</span><span class="p">,</span> <span class="n">info</span> <span class="o">=</span> <span class="n">env</span><span class="o">.</span><span class="n">reset</span><span class="p">()</span>
|
||
<span class="n">done</span> <span class="o">=</span> <span class="kc">False</span>
|
||
|
||
<span class="c1"># play one episode</span>
|
||
<span class="k">while</span> <span class="ow">not</span> <span class="n">done</span><span class="p">:</span>
|
||
<span class="n">action</span> <span class="o">=</span> <span class="n">agent</span><span class="o">.</span><span class="n">get_action</span><span class="p">(</span><span class="n">obs</span><span class="p">)</span>
|
||
<span class="n">next_obs</span><span class="p">,</span> <span class="n">reward</span><span class="p">,</span> <span class="n">terminated</span><span class="p">,</span> <span class="n">truncated</span><span class="p">,</span> <span class="n">info</span> <span class="o">=</span> <span class="n">env</span><span class="o">.</span><span class="n">step</span><span class="p">(</span><span class="n">action</span><span class="p">)</span>
|
||
|
||
<span class="c1"># update the agent</span>
|
||
<span class="n">agent</span><span class="o">.</span><span class="n">update</span><span class="p">(</span><span class="n">obs</span><span class="p">,</span> <span class="n">action</span><span class="p">,</span> <span class="n">reward</span><span class="p">,</span> <span class="n">terminated</span><span class="p">,</span> <span class="n">next_obs</span><span class="p">)</span>
|
||
|
||
<span class="c1"># update if the environment is done and the current obs</span>
|
||
<span class="n">done</span> <span class="o">=</span> <span class="n">terminated</span> <span class="ow">or</span> <span class="n">truncated</span>
|
||
<span class="n">obs</span> <span class="o">=</span> <span class="n">next_obs</span>
|
||
|
||
<span class="n">agent</span><span class="o">.</span><span class="n">decay_epsilon</span><span class="p">()</span>
|
||
</pre></div>
|
||
</div>
